If your bathtub is made of plastic, you should steer clear of cleaning solutions that include acids or alkalis.The use of strong chemicals such as bleach, acetone, paint thinner, and cleaners packaged in aerosol cans is not recommended when cleaning acrylic plastic tubs.If bleach is not diluted, it has the potential to deteriorate plastic bathtubs, despite the fact that it is an extremely efficient disinfectant. Solvents, which you should never use on plastic tub surrounds, include mineral spirits, turpentine and acetone. Luckily, there are several methods to restore shine to plastic bathroom units at home. Step 4. Finish by rinsing the bathtub completely. Make a paste using baking soda and water, the consistency of which should be comparable to that of toothpaste. Any soft, nonabrasive cleaning tool, such as a microfiber or terry cloth towel, and a sponge, rag, scrubber or brush labeled "nonabrasive" can be used to clean a plastic tub surround without risk of scratching it. Acrylic or plastic bathtubs and tub surrounds call for nonabrasive cleaning products only. If you're using dish soap, mix a generous squeeze of the soap into a basin of warm water; soak your cloth, sponge or other tool in the soapy water; and apply it all over the tub surround.
